Black Hair, Blue Eyes: The Design Logic
Let’s talk about the nitty gritty! Why is this color combination so common from a design perspective?

Visual Distinctiveness
In anime, character designs need to be instantly recognizable. Black hair and blue eyes create a strong visual contrast that helps characters stand out on screen. Think about it: a sea of brown-haired characters can get confusing. Blue eyes immediately draw attention.
Symbolism and Psychology
Color psychology plays a huge role in character design. As we discussed earlier, black represents strength and mystery, while blue represents hope and intelligence. These colors communicate subconscious messages to the viewer, shaping their perception of the character.
